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III Salary in Gainesville, GA

How much does a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III make in Gainesville, GA?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for a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III in Gainesville, GA is $79,383 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$38.

However, a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$98,889
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$72,873 to $89,593
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$66,946

How Experience Level Affects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of a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here's how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• CNC Programmer, Entry (0-2 years): $58,997
  • CNC Programmer, Experienced (2-4 years): $67,328
  •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III (4-7 years): $79,366
  • CNC Programmer, Lead (7+ years): $101,899

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III Salary by Company Size: Startups vs. Enterprise

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III salary potential scales significantly with company size. Data shows that Enterprise companies (5,000+ employees) pay the highest average salary at around $89,815. While startup companies pay approximate $76,029.

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 40%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Aerospace & Defense and MFG Durable s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 20% above the average. In contrast,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er positions in MFG Nondurable or Energy & Utilities typ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Computer Numeric Controlled Machine Programmer III as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.
